What Is Corrugated Pipe?
Corrugated pipe refers to a type of pipe with a ribbed (corrugated) outer surface and a smooth or structured inner wall. This design provides high strength while maintaining flexibility.
Common types include:
Plastic corrugated pipe
HDPE Corrugated Pipes
Double wall corrugated pipes
These pipes are lightweight, easy to install, and resistant to corrosion, making them ideal for underground and outdoor applications.
What Is Corrugated Pipe Used For?
Corrugated pipes are widely used across multiple industries:
1. Drainage Systems
Stormwater drainage
Underground drainage systems
Agricultural drainage
2. Cable Protection
Electrical conduit systems
Fiber optic cable protection
Underground cable routing
3. Construction & Infrastructure
Road and highway drainage
Culverts and sewage systems
Foundation drainage
4. Industrial Applications
Fluid transportation
Ventilation systems
Thanks to their flexibility and durability, corrugated pipes are suitable for both residential and large-scale commercial projects.
Advantages of Plastic Corrugated Pipe
1. Lightweight & Easy Installation
Compared to traditional pipes, plastic corrugated pipe is easier to transport and install, reducing labor costs.
2. High Strength & Flexibility
The corrugated structure allows the pipe to withstand external pressure while adapting to ground movement.
3. Corrosion Resistance
Unlike metal pipes, plastic corrugated pipes do not rust, ensuring a longer service life.
4. Cost-Effective Solution
Lower material and installation costs make corrugated pipes a popular choice for many projects.
Types of Corrugated Pipes
1. Single Wall Corrugated Pipes
Lightweight and flexible
Used for cable protection and light drainage
2. Double Wall Corrugated Pipes
Stronger structure
Suitable for underground drainage and heavy-duty applications
